I had a great evening meeting the team at IFAW at a reception for MPs to see their whale research vessel’ The Song Of The Whale’ moored in St Katherines Docks in London last night, July 6th 2011.It sets off to Jersey today to the International Whaling Commission 2011 annual meeting. IFAW help to keep the ban on whaling in place. The vessel is important because it demonstrates to MPs that whales do not have to be killed to be studied for ‘scientific purposes’ as some countries claim like Japan. The vessel has state of the art monitoring and photo digitaling equipment.
